Quote:
Originally Posted by kjjb0204 View Post
Isn't Verizon's EVDO a 3G bb? Cause I can't send or receive emails while using the phone either.
Yes, EVDO is a 3G wireless technology.
3G just means it a "3rd Generation" type of wireless transport.
Having 3G doesn't automatically mean that you get simultaneous voice and data.
For that, you'd need UMTS.
Universal Mobile Telecommunications System -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

You can't get UMTS on Verizon's current CDMA network.
